Nintendo responds to Euro Smash Bros. Brawl Wii issues

It would seem that there have been many European gamers complaining that Nintendo’s recent release of Super Smash Bros. Brawl on Wii this Friday across the continent has not been a smooth one, with various disc errors occurring, much like the situation that the company faced when releasing the first dual-layered Wii title in the Japanese and North American regions. It would appear that the standard response has indeed been rolled out again, though.

Many believed that considering Nintendo’s heavy delay for the European release of many people’s most wanted Wii game of 2008 the issue relating to ‘dirty Wii consoles’ having trouble reading the new double-layer Wii DVDs would have been resolved. Sadly, though, the delay was obviously just for marketing purposes and not resolve this game-breaking problem. Below is Nintendo’s standard line on the matter:

“If you have recently purchased Super Smash Bros. Brawl and are experiencing technical problems playing the game on your Wii, please read the following information to learn how this issue can be resolved. Super Smash Bros. Brawl utilises a double-layer disc that has a large memory capacity. A very small percentage of Wii consoles may have trouble consistently reading data off this large capacity disc if there is some contamination on the lens of the disc drive. Nintendo has specialised cleaning equipment that can resolve this problem. Please do NOT attempt to clean the lens yourself, as you may damage the system.

“If you are experiencing disc read errors, please contact Consumer Support. They will provide information regarding sending your Wii to Nintendo to have the disc drive lens cleaned. There is no cost for the repair or shipping. (Please note: Returning the disc to the retail store will not solve the problem. We encourage users who are experiencing issues with playing Super Smash Bros. Brawl to utilise Nintendo’s repair service.) Due to the nature of this particular issue, Wii owners should not lose any of their stored data, such as Virtual Console games and WiiWare software. In some rare cases you may have to re-download this software from the Wii Shop Channel, but there is no cost to doing so.”
